Also, you will have to see on what material that fire pit is built with. They give you an idea on the relative durability of the fixture. This decision is also something that impinges on your style preference and needs. That is why its build and makeup can incur a huge impact on the results and your satisfaction. There are pits made of steel, some of tile and stone, and those mad of copper, cast iron, or else of stainless steel.
They all differ by price and quality. The great deal with steel is that it is greatly malleable and amenable to be molded in a variety of shapes. The caveat, of course, is corrosion. However, this can be precluded when you go the extra length of power coating. Theyre handcrafted, so you may have the artistic pleasure of noting that theyre unique all on their own. Theres also tile and stone, which ups the game for artsy ness and uniqueness. The caveat is that they are pretty hefty, so you wont likely find small and portable variations in this regard.
